Impact Assessment Study on the alignment of the Pressure Equipment Directive to the CLP Regulation

The Impact Assessment Study on the alignment of the Pressure Equipment Directive to the Classification, Labelling and Packaging (CLP) Regulation was conducted in 2012-2013.

The study analyses the changes required to Article 9 of the Directive in view of the classification of the fluids on the basis of the CLP Regulation which is going to replace the current classification under the Dangerous Substances Directive 67/548/EEC (DSD).

The CLP Regulation is implementing the Globally Harmonised System (GHS) of Classification and Labelling of Chemicals in the EU.  

The CLP Regulation will replace the Dangerous Substances Directive over a transitional period that will end on 31 May 2015.  

Downstream legislation that  refers to the Dangerous Substances Directive - including the PED - will need to be aligned to the CLP Regulation.

Please note that the alignment options in the study are presented  by the contractor and do not necessarily reflect the position of the European Commission services.
